Further information provided by the department

Special features regarding teaching

Wide-ranging study offers at the interface of natural and engineering sciences, both nationally and internationally; Many options for continuing education; Online degree course in Regulators Affairs (master's degree, 100 % online); Very good equipment for laboratory practicals

Special features regarding the international orientation

international degree courses: Master's degree in Biomedical Engineering (jointly with the University of Lübeck); Master’s degree in Medical Microtechnology (jointly with the University of Lübeck and Syddansk University in Sonderborg, Denmark); Bachelor’s degree in Environmental Engineering: Cooperation with the East China University of Science and Technology (double degree programme)

Special features regarding the equipment

Very good laboratory equipment, especially in biomedical engineering, audiology and applied chemistry

Special features regarding research and development

Close contacts with the neighbouring University of Lübeck: Joint degree programmes and research activities; Joint competence centre TANDEM in the field of medical engineering; Joint research with local institutions in audiology
